Advanced Pathophysiology and Pharmacology for Nurse Educators
Course Description
This course focuses on advanced physiology, pathophysiology, and pharmacologic principles. This course will guide the Nursing Education student in interpreting changes in normal function that result in symptoms indicative of illness and the effects of select pharmacologic substances on that process. Evidence-based research provides the basis for determining the safe and appropriate utilization of medications and herbal therapies on human function. Appropriate education for various prescribed pharmacologic agents is incorporated.

Topic 1: General Physiological and Pathophysiological Concepts
Description
Objectives:
Evaluate different forms of cell membrane transport.
Compare and contrast the mechanisms of cellular injury and the processes of cellular adaptation.
Evaluate the inflammatory response as a defense mechanism.
Describe principles of immunology in disease processes.
Evaluate the principles of cellular alterations in infection and the medications that treat infection.NUR 641E : Advanced Pathophysiology and Pharmacology for Nurse Educators

Topic 2: Principles for Safe Use of Pharmacologic and Herbal Substances
Description
Objectives:
Analyze the impact of pharmacologic agents on a patient’s health status considering physiology, pathophysiology, pharmacokinetics, pharmacodynamics, and patient knowledge.
Evaluate drug actions to promote safe and effective drug therapy.
Identify ethnic, cultural, and genetic differences in patients that may affect the safety or efficacy of medications.
Integrate knowledge of pathophysiology and pharmacology into teaching and educational materials in diverse settings.NUR 641E : Advanced Pathophysiology and Pharmacology for Nurse Educators
